The goal of the UC3M Bachelor’s Degree in Tourism is to form professionals who are prepared to direct and manage tourism companies, identify and undertake business initiatives, manage and supervise companies or other public or private institutions in the sector, manage and plan resources, itineraries and tourist destinations and create specific products. This degree offers students in-depth knowledge of the tourism sector that will enable them to adapt to the constant changes of the market. Students will acquire a multidisciplinary education that integrates the disciplines involved in the tourism sector: economics, business, law, geography, sociology, history, art, urban planning, computer science and literature, among others. Given its practical and applied nature, they will be able to broaden their knowledge of the profession with internships in leading companies, entities and organizations.

All persons applying for admission to the universities of Madrid in the pre-enrollment process participate with a score of up to 14 points, consisting of two parameters:

  • Qualification for Admission to Spanish University (CAU in Spanish): up to 10 points.
  • Improvement of the admission grade: up to 4 points.
